Compatibility and connection

Compatible with your system, whatever it is

It is the question we are asked most often, and the answer fits in one sentence: an AC-coupled battery does not talk to your inverter. It sits behind the meter, watches what comes into the house and what goes out, and reacts. The make of your panels, the age of your inverter, the name of your installer: none of it comes into play.

Yes

You already have panels

Any make, any age, string inverter or microinverters. The battery has nothing to negotiate with them. It simply sees the house exporting current, and keeps it.

Yes

You have no panels at all

The battery still works. It fills up during cheap hours and gives back during peak hours. The gain is smaller than with solar and depends on your tariff, so we do not put a figure on it in the calculator, which assumes a solar system.

To check

Your meter

This is the one point that changes from home to home. The battery needs to read what the house is using. Depending on what your meter exposes, that takes no tools at all or calls for an electrician. What that means.

Two ways to connect

The first covers the great majority of cases and needs nobody. The second belongs to the installer, and goes further.

1
Main method

On a socket, AC coupling

The battery plugs into a Swiss socket. A sensor tells it what the house is using, and it adjusts to the watt.

  1. The battery plugs into an ordinary Swiss socket. No wiring, no board opened.
  2. The sensor sits on the meter and takes its data. Over the P1 port where there is one, by infrared reading otherwise.
  3. Pairing happens on a smartphone over Bluetooth, then the battery joins the household Wi-Fi.
Who
You, with no electrician
Time
About ten minutes
Output power
600 W, the ceiling of the plug & play regime
Solar system
Works with any existing solar system, and with no solar system at all

Models concerned: Venus E 3.0, Venus E 4.0, Venus E Max, Venus E Mini

2
Advanced method

Panels wired directly, MPPT inputs

The panels are wired to the unit’s inputs. Solar current reaches the cells without a conversion to alternating current, so that much less is lost.

  1. The panels are wired to the unit’s MPPT inputs, with no inverter in between.
  2. Efficiency gains from it: one conversion fewer between panel and cell. The gain is real, since every conversion costs a few points of efficiency, but we will not put a figure on it until we have measured it ourselves on these units.
  3. The cap can be lifted by the electrician who wires the unit permanently, with notification to the grid operator and a safety report.
Who
You for a balcony, an electrician for a roof
Time
Half a day for a roof
Output power
Up to the unit’s rated power, once a professional has unlocked it
Solar system
Assumes panels dedicated to the battery, not a system already wired to an inverter

Models concerned: Venus A, Venus D

One clarification that avoids a misunderstanding. On a balcony, wiring the panels straight to a Venus A or a Venus D needs no electrician: that is how these units normally work. What needs a professional is the permanent connection to the consumer unit, and it is that, not the panel wiring, which allows the 600 W cap to be lifted. What lifting the cap changes.

And beyond: the hybrid inverter

Solar, storage, backup and control in a single unit, wired to the consumer unit. This is the fixed electrical installation regime. It replaces or supplements the existing inverter, and the study is part of the job. At that point you leave plug & play: this is a fixed electrical installation, fitted by a licensed electrician. Applies to Venus G — contrôleur monophasé 5 kW, Venus G — contrôleur triphasé 10 kW, Mars I Plus SP. See residential systems.

The meter: the only real question

A battery that does not know what the house is using works blind. With measurement, it adjusts to the watt. Two sensors, depending on what your meter is willing to show.

Common case

Smart Meter CT003

Your meter has an accessible P1 port

The unit plugs into the meter’s P1 port and reads the official values in real time. Where there is no P1 port, it can also read the meter’s infrared diode: fitting is magnetic, with no tools.

Fitting: You, with no electrician

Smart Meter CT002

Your meter exposes nothing, or the P1 port is locked by the grid operator

Current clamps fitted in the distribution board measure the current on each phase. This method works everywhere, three-phase included.

Fitting: Licensed electrician, because the work happens inside the board

The Swiss meter estate is uneven: which model is fitted, which protocol is enabled and whether the P1 port is open depend on your grid operator, sometimes on your municipality. We check your meter’s compatibility before dispatch, and we do not ship a battery that could not read yours. The three reading methods in detail.

Setup and control

A smartphone is enough. No computer, no software to install on a PC, no subscription.

Wireless
Wi-Fi 2,4 GHz · Bluetooth 5.2
App
Marstek app, iOS and Android
  1. Plug in the battery and the sensor.
  2. Open the app and pair the two devices over Bluetooth.
  3. Give them your Wi-Fi network: monitoring then works remotely.
  4. Choose the operating mode: self-consumption, time windows, or manual.

Bluetooth handles pairing and works even without a network. Wi-Fi handles remote monitoring and updates. A battery with no Wi-Fi keeps working: you then control it over Bluetooth, within range.
